Sinestro
Green Lantern: Sinestro is a Green Lantern storyline published as part of The New 52, concurrently with Blood and Rage, Fearsome and The Ring Bearer. Following the timeline reboot in Flashpoint, it establishes the series' mythology in DCnU continuity. It's the debut arc of Geoff Johns and Doug Mahnke's new Green Lantern volume. Mexady Invasion
Galada Eutopas, warlord ruler of the planet Mexady, finds that his conquering of Mexady depleted the populace of women to reproduce. His chief scientist, Ursulis, informs Eutopas of Earth, surmising that the populace may have suitable females. Developing the technology to do so, Ursulis guides Mexady toward Earth at the will of Eutopas.
